Homeowners looking to upgrade to a bigger, better property can now take advantage of the Part Exchange scheme at Taylor Wimpey’s The Pastures development of new build homes in Kent.

This fantastic scheme lets customers relax in their current home until their new place is ready to move into, with Taylor Wimpey acting as their guaranteed buyer – and it is available now with selected family-size houses for sale in Kent.

Part Exchange customers receive an agreed price for their existing property, based on the average of independent professional valuations, with the added security of a firm cash buyer, so there’s nothing standing in the way of their move.

Homes at The Pastures are set around an attractive green with a pretty duck pond, and have Hoo’s village amenities on the doorstep including a parish church, recreation grounds, schools and a choice of pubs. Hoo Common and the Marina offer ample opportunities for leisure, including walking, cycling and boating.

Just a stone’s throw away are the Medway towns of Rochester and Gillingham, home to a wider range of shopping and leisure opportunities in addition to regular, 50-minute rail services from Gillingham station to London Victoria. The Pastures is also within easy reach of the Channel ports and Eurostar services.
